1. Examine the Water Meter



Every residence has a water meter. Checking it is a proven manner in which aids you uncover leaks. For beginners, turn off all the water resources. Ensure nobody will flush, use the tap, shower, run the cleaning device or dish washer. From there, go to the meter as well as watch if it will alter. Given that no one is utilizing it, there should be no motions. That shows a fast-moving leak if it moves. Furthermore, if you spot no changes, wait an hour or more and examine back again. This means you may have a sluggish leakage that can even be underground.

 

 

2. Check Water Consumption



If you find unexpected changes, despite your consumption being the very same, it indicates that you have leakages in your plumbing system. An abrupt spike in your costs indicates a fast-moving leakage.

On the other hand, a steady boost each month, despite the exact same routines, shows you have a slow leakage that's likewise slowly escalating. Call a plumber to thoroughly examine your property, specifically if you really feel a warm area on your flooring with piping beneath.

Signs You Have a Hidden Plumbing Leak

 

Damaged floors, walls, or ceilings

 

Water-damaged floors, walls, and ceilings are often warped, sagging, drooping, or covered in stains. You might also notice that the paint is chipping off of your walls due to water coming into contact with and separating the paint from the wall surface.



 

Extra-green patches of grass

 

Because pipes are often underground, it is not uncommon for a leak to affect your lawn. If you find that a certain area of your grass is growing faster than other areas of your lawn, there might just be an underground leak.



 

Higher-than-usual water bills

 

If your water bill is much too high each month, and it doesn’t seem to match up with your actual water usage, something is definitely up with your system.

 

Continuously running meter

 

Your water meter should not be running all of the time. If you turn off all running water in your home and your water meter still shows that water is running, there is a leak somewhere in your system.
